DEFINITION OF AN “EMPLOYER”Under the WC Act of <strong>New</strong> <strong>Brunswick</strong>, an “employer” is:• Every person having in their service under contract of hire or apprenticeship, written or oral, expressed or implied,any worker engaged in any work in or about an industry.• A municipal corporation, commission, committee, body or other local authority established or exercising anypowers or authority with respect to the affairs or purposes, including school purposes, of a municipality.• A person who authorizes or permits a learner to be in or about an industry <strong>for</strong> the purposes mentioned in thedefinition “learner”.• A deemed employer.• The Crown in right of the Province of <strong>New</strong> <strong>Brunswick</strong>, and of Canada, and any permanent board, commission, orcorporation established by the Crown in right of the Province of <strong>New</strong> <strong>Brunswick</strong>, or of Canada, in so far as they, oreither of them, in their capacity as employers, submit to the operation of this Act.What if I am self-employed?<strong>WorkSafeNB</strong> generally does not cover individuals who are self-employed. However, if you are self-employed butunder contract, you become a worker of the principal contractor and compensation coverage is provided through theprincipal contractor.DEFINITION OF A “WORKER”The WC Act of <strong>New</strong> <strong>Brunswick</strong> states that a “worker” means a person who has entered into orworks under a contract of service or apprenticeship, written or oral, expressed or implied,whether by way of manual labour or otherwise, and includes:• A learner.• An emergency services worker within the meaning of any agreement made under the EmergencyMeasures Act between the Government of Canada and the Government of <strong>New</strong> <strong>Brunswick</strong> in whichprovision is made <strong>for</strong> compensation with respect to the injury or death of such workers.• A member of a municipal volunteer fire brigade.• A person employed in a management capacity by the employer, including an executive officer of acorporation, where that executive officer is carried on the payroll.6
